Salt Composition

Diclofenac (50mg) + Metaxalone (400mg)

Overview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et

Muscle spasm pain is treated with the combined medication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et. This medication enhances muscle mobility and alleviates pain and discomfort linked to muscle spasms. For optimal absorption,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ablets should be taken on an empty stomach, consistently as prescribed by your physician. Never exceed the recommended dosage or duration.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, abdominal pain, indigestion, diarrhea, drowsiness, and appetite loss. Report any persistent or bothersome side effects to your doctor; management strategies may be available. Prior to use, individuals with pre-existing heart, kidney, or liver conditions, or those taking other medications, should inform their doctor. Similarly, pregnant or breastfeeding women must consult their physician before commencing treatment.

How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et works:

Each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ablet combines diclofenac, a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ID), with metaxalone, a muscle relaxant, to alleviate pain and muscle tension. Diclofenac inhibits the production of pain and inflammation-inducing chemical messengers, reducing swelling and redness. Metaxalone acts centrally on the brain and spinal cord to ease muscle stiffness and spasms, thereby improving mobility and reducing discomfort.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Combining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ets with alcohol is not advisable due to safety concerns.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Using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to the fetus. Therefore, it's unsafe. Exceptions may exist in life-threatening circumstances where a physician deems the potential benefits outweigh the risks. Always se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icate a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

For individuals with kidney impairment, the use of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ets requires careful consideration. Dosage modification of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ets might be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verCAUTION

The use of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ets requires careful consideration in individuals with hepatic impairment. Dosage modifications for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. For patients with liver disease undergoing prolonged treatment, routine liver function assessments are recommended.

What if you forget to take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et :

Should you forget to take your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et

Each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ablet contains Diclofenac and Metaxalone, which together alleviate muscle pain. The medication achieves this by inducing muscle relaxation through central nervous system activity and reducing the body's pain and inflammation-causing compounds.
The medication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et is typically prescribed for short-term use, ceasing once pain subsides. Nevertheless, continue taking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et if your physician recommends ongoing treatment.
Nausea and vomiting are possible side effects of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ablets. Consuming the tablets with milk, food, or antacids may mitigate nausea. Fatty or fried foods should be avoided while taking this medication. If vomiting occurs, increase fluid intake. Persistent vomiting accompanied by symptoms of dehydration, such as dark, strong-smelling urine and infrequent urination, warrants medical attention. Always consult a physician before taking any other medication concurrently.
Dizziness, including faintness, weakness, unsteadiness, or lightheadedness, is a potential side effect of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et in certain individuals. Should dizziness occur, temporary rest is advised; activities should be resumed only after symptoms subside.
Patients with documented hypersensitivity to n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) or any constituent of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et should not use this medication. Individuals with a history of peptic ulcers or active gastrointestinal bleeding should ideally refrain from taking this medicine. Similarly, its use is contraindicated in patients with pre-existing heart failure, hypertension, or hepatic or renal impairment.
Prolonged Dixmeta 50mg/400mg Tablet consumption may indeed harm the kidneys. This is because the kidneys naturally produce prostaglandins, protective chemicals. Pain relievers, including this medication, reduce prostaglandin levels, increasing the risk of kidney damage with extended use. Individuals with pre-existing kidney conditions should avoid such painkillers.
Exceeding the prescribed dosage of Dixmeta 50mg/400mg tablets elevates the risk of adverse reactions. Should your pain worsen or fail to respond to the recommended dose, seek medical advice for reassessment.
Store this medication in its original, tightly sealed container, following all storage instructions provided on the packaging. Discard any leftover medication; prevent access by children, pets, and others.
